Learn how to solve differential calculus problems step by step online. Find the derivative of e^ (2x)+3. The derivative of a sum of two or more functions is the sum of the derivatives of each function. The derivative of the constant function (3) is equal to zero. If that something is just an expression you can write d (expression)/dx. so if expression is x^2 then it's derivative is represented as d (x^2)/dx. 2. If we decide to use the functional notation, viz. f (x) then derivative is represented as d f (x)/dx.
